NFRC rating system and labeling system for energy performance windows and doors, skylights and attachment products

The National Fenestration Rating Council is an independent non-profit corporation that provides an uniform and independent labeling system for assessing the energy efficiency of windows and doors skylights, windows, and other attachment products. This label lets consumers make informed choices about energy-efficient products.

Energy ratings complement other NFRC labels, including air quality and structural performance ratings. These ratings can be used to determine the energy efficiency of a structure.

In addition to determining the insulation value of the window, ratings also quantify the performance of sealants, weatherstripping and insulating glass units. They also assess visible light transmittance.

NFRC labels are available for various regions and provide more details about a product other than the R-value or U-factor. They provide ratings for Solar Heat Gain Coefficient as well as Visible Light Transmittance, Solar Heat Gain Coefficient, Condensation Resistance, Air Leakage, and other factors.

NFRC-certified products have been independently verified and tested by a third party. The certification process is a non-biased evaluation of the product's manufacturing and design as well as participation to the NFRC rating system and labeling system.

The NFRC is a member of numerous companies in the fenestration sector. The organization was formed in response to the energy crises in the 1970s. Today, NFRC is composed of government agencies, manufacturers researchers, suppliers, and other manufacturers. Its ratings are utilized in the major energy efficiency programs.
